'We must learn to love, learn to be kind, and this from our earliest youth ... Likewise, hatred must be learned and nurtured, if one wishes to become a proficient hater'This volume contains a selection of Nietzsche's brilliant and challenging aphorisms, examining the pleasures of revenge, the falsity of pity, and the incompatibility of marriage with the philosophical life.Introducing Little Black Classics- 80 books for Penguin's 80th birthday. Little Black Classics celebrate the huge range and diversity of Penguin Classics, with books from around the world and across many centuries. They take us from a balloon ride over Victorian London to a garden of blossom in Japan, from Tierra del Fuego to 16th-century California and the Russian steppe. Here are stories lyrical and savage; poems epic and intimate; essays satirical and inspirational; and ideas that have shaped the lives of millions.… (més)

A very short collection of thought-provoking 'psychological maxims' (pg. 2). Nietzsche might be overstating it when he calls this sort of psychological and philosophical endeavour "the richest and most harmless source of entertainment" (pg. 1), but there are certainly worse ways to spend your time (and such a small amount of time too). Nietzsche's statements are ruthlessly interesting, but they are very much statements. The bitesize nature of the aphorisms means that the book lacks the comprehensiveness (in theme, not necessarily because of length) that a philosophical piece needs if it is to really influence how you think. Certainly, I'll be coming back to him. ( )
